A PATIENT pest who caused two disturbances at Borders General Hospital within the space of four days has avoided a prison sentence at Jedburgh Sheriff Court.

Thirty one year old Karen Turner from Howegate pleaded guilty to shouting and swearing and acting in an aggressive manner in the accident and emergency department on August 21.

She also admitted threatening or abusive behaviour in an ambulance and also at the hospital on August 25 when she struggled with police and kicked a female officer on the leg.

Turner also pleaded guilty to struggling violently with three people and kicking a door during another incident in Howegate, Hawick, on August 13.

She was ordered to carry out 80 hours of unpaid work as part of an 18 month community pay back order.
